What is the Zodiac Sign for June?
The June sign zodiac is not a single sign but two. The month begins under the influence of Gemini and transitions into Cancer around the third week. This division is based on the Earth's orbit around the Sun and the Sun's apparent path through the zodiac constellations.
Here is the clear date breakdown for the June sign zodiac:
- Gemini: May 21 – June 21. People born during this period are Geminis.
- Cancer: June 22 – July 22. People born from June 22 onward are Cancers.
It is important to note that these dates can vary slightly from year to year due to the Earth's orbit. For the most accurate determination, you should consult an ephemeris or a birth chart calculator that uses your exact time and location of birth. However, for general purposes, these dates are widely accepted.
This split means that the June sign zodiac offers a blend of intellectual air energy and emotional water energy. Early June is dominated by the quick, communicative nature of Gemini, while late June ushers in the sensitive, nurturing vibe of Cancer. Understanding this division is the first step in unlocking the astrological secrets of your June birthday.
| Part of June | Zodiac Sign | Exact Dates | Element | Symbol |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Beginning of June | Gemini ♊ | May 21 – June 21 | Air | The Twins |
| End of June | Cancer ♋ | June 22 – July 22 | Water | The Crab |
Gemini (June 1–21): The Twins of the Zodiac
Gemini is the third sign of the zodiac and is represented by the Twins. It is an Air sign, which means its energy is intellectual, communicative, and social. The ruling planet of Gemini is Mercury, the planet of communication, travel, and intellect. This combination makes Geminis naturally curious, adaptable, and quick-witted.
People born under the June sign zodiac as Geminis are known for their love of learning and variety. They thrive on new ideas, conversations, and experiences. They can be charming, funny, and excellent storytellers. However, their dual nature can also make them appear indecisive or inconsistent at times.
The Decans of Gemini in June
The June sign zodiac is further refined by decans, which are 10-day divisions within a sign. Gemini has three decans, and two of them fall within June.
Gemini 2nd Decan (June 1–10)
This decan is ruled by Venus, the planet of love and beauty. People born during this period are more sentimental and affectionate than other Geminis. They still possess the intellectual curiosity of their sign, but they are more in touch with their emotions and the feelings of others. They are often drawn to careers in counseling, teaching, or the arts. They are romantic and expressive, but they still value their independence.
Gemini 3rd Decan (June 11–21)
This decan is ruled by Uranus, the planet of innovation and rebellion. People born during this period are the most unpredictable and visionary of all Geminis. They are futuristic, open-minded, and often fascinated by technology. They can be eccentric and may have unconventional ideas. They value freedom above all else and can be aloof in relationships. They make excellent entrepreneurs, programmers, and inventors.
In summary, the June sign zodiac for those born in the first three weeks is Gemini. Their personality is shaped by the Air element and Mercury's influence, with additional nuances provided by the specific decan they are born in.
Cancer (June 22–30): The Nurturing Crab
Cancer is the fourth sign of the zodiac and is represented by the Crab. It is a Water sign, which means its energy is emotional, intuitive, and nurturing. The ruling planet of Cancer is the Moon, which governs emotions, instincts, and the subconscious. This combination makes Cancers deeply sensitive, caring, and protective.
People born under the June sign zodiac as Cancers are known for their strong connection to home and family. They are natural nurturers who create a safe and comfortable environment for their loved ones. They are highly intuitive and can often sense the needs of others before they are expressed. However, their sensitivity can also make them moody or defensive at times.
The Decans of Cancer in June
Cancer also has three decans, and only the first decan falls within June.
Cancer 1st Decan (June 22–30)
This decan is ruled by the Moon itself. People born during this period embody the purest and most intense Cancer traits. They are the most sensitive, vulnerable, and nurturing of all Cancers. They have a hard outer shell (like a crab) that protects their soft, emotional interior. They are deeply attached to their home and family and seek security in all areas of life. They are natural empaths and make excellent parents, therapists, and caregivers.
The June sign zodiac for those born in the last week is Cancer. Their personality is deeply influenced by the Water element and the Moon's cycles. They are emotional, intuitive, and deeply loyal, with a strong need for security and connection.

June Birthstones: Pearl and Alexandrite
June has two birthstones: Pearl and Alexandrite.
- Pearl: Pearls are the only gemstones created by living creatures. They symbolize wisdom, purity, loyalty, and generosity. Pearls are said to have a calming effect that strengthens relationships and balances karma. This stone resonates well with the nurturing energy of Cancer.
- Alexandrite: This rare stone is known for its color-changing ability—appearing green in daylight and red under lamplight. It is believed to inspire creativity, imagination, and intuition. Alexandrite's dual nature echoes the dual energy of the June sign zodiac, bridging the intellectual Gemini and the emotional Cancer.

What if I was born on the cusp (June 21–22)?
If you were born on June 21 or 22, you may be on the cusp between Gemini and Cancer. In some years, the Sun moves into Cancer on June 21, while in others it happens on June 22. To know for sure, you should check your exact birth time and location using a birth chart calculator. People born on the cusp often blend traits from both signs.
